Perennials and ferns offer a magnificent way to craft a abundant landscape that needs minimal maintenance. These resilient plants prosper in various conditions, enhancing year-round beauty to your outdoor space.
Choosing the right perennials and ferns for your locale is crucial. Evaluate factors like illumination, soil texture, and humidity levels. Forming a layered landscape with plants of varying heights and textures ensures a dynamic display throughout the seasons.
Incorporating ferns into your plan offers a touch of serenity. Their fragrant foliage forms a verdant backdrop for bolder perennials. Combining ferns with complementary perennials, such as colorful varieties or those with special shapes, heightens the visual impact.
Regular attention is critical to ensure your perennial and fern display thrives. Covering a layer of mulch around your plants helps preserve moisture, suppresses weeds, and stabilizes soil temperature. Supplementation during dry periods is also necessary to keep your plants strong.

Perennial Power: Bringing Life to Your Borders
Tired of seasonal pops that fade away after a short time? Embrace the beauty of perennial power! These long-lasting plants offer a prolonged display of color and texture, transforming your borders into vibrant masterpieces that come back year after year.
Perennials thrive on easy maintenance, requiring less watering and fertilizing than their annual counterparts. They create a dense landscape that attracts pollinators and supports beneficial wildlife.
- Choose perennials that are suited to your climate and soil conditions.
- Plant perennials in a range of heights and textures for a multi-dimensional border design.
- Cluster plants with similar preferences together for optimal growth.
The Art of Layering: Trees, Shrubs, and More
Layering your landscape is a fantastic technique to build visual depth. It involves planting different types of check here plants at various heights, from tall trees and low-growing groundcovers. This creates a harmonious design that is both beautiful.
To excel the art of layering, consider the following tips:
- Begin with a strong dominant feature like a large tree.
- Arrange shrubs of medium height around your focal feature.
- Fill the gaps with low-growing plants like perennials, groundcovers.
Remember, mixing and matching is key.
